Anne Canteaut Pascale Charpin

In a recent paper [1], it is shown that the restrictions of bent functions to subspaces of codimension 1 and 2 are highly nonlinear. Here, we present an extensive study of the restrictions of bent functions to affine subspaces. We propose several methods which are mainly based on properties of the derivatives and of the dual of a given bent function. We solve an open problem due to Hou [2]. We ...

Pantelimon Stanica

In this paper we introduce a sequence of discrete Fourier transforms and define new versions of bent functions, which we shall call (weak, strong) octa/hexa/2-bent functions. We investigate relationships between these classes and completely characterize the octabent and hexabent functions in terms of bent functions.

Anna Bernasconi Bruno Codenotti Jeffrey M. Vanderkam

In this note we prove that bent functions can be precisely characterized in terms of a special class of strongly regular graphs, thus providing a positive answer to a question raised in the paper Spectral Analysis of Boolean Functions as a Graph Eigenvalue Problem. Lilya Budaghyan Claude Carlet

We prove that, for bent vectorial functions, CCZ-equivalence coincides with EA-equivalence. However, we show that CCZ-equivalence can be used for constructing bent functions which are new up to CCZequivalence. Using this approach we construct classes of nonquadratic bent Boolean and bent vectorial functions.
